Atkins Library at UNC Charlotte is accepting applications for our Atkins
Fellows summer program. Applications submitted by Tuesday, February 21 will
receive first consideration. These fellowships are designed to give LIS
students hands-on experience in an academic library.

The Atkins Fellows program is an eleven-week summer residential fellowship
for students at the mid-point of their Library, Archives, or Information
Science degree program. It is designed to provide each Fellow who
participates with a work experience that is focused on professional-level
tasks, with high level of independence and creativity, while also
supporting Atkins Library's mission, goals, and initiatives.  The six
projects proposed for 2017 are in the areas of Public Services, Assessment
and Analytics, Digital Image Processing, Technology Services, Born-Digital
University Records, and Electronic Resource Management. Participants in
this program will receive a $6,000 stipend, paid at an hourly rate
($13.64/hour, for eleven weeks of forty hours per week).

*Description*:
Atkins Library collects and manages thousands of electronic resources. In
order to manage all of the electronic resources effectively, the library is
implementing an Electronic Resources Management System (ERMS). The fellow
will work with the Electronic and Continuing Resources Librarian and the
Collection Development Librarian on creating workflows for adding
information to the system, help populate the system, and code licenses to
determine what information should be included. Through this work they will
learn the intricacies of electronic resources management including
acquisitions, licensing, and assessment and be prepared to perform this
work in a professional capacity upon completion of the fellowship.

*Preferred Education/Training, Experience, Skills/Competencies:*
Basic familiarity with the MARC cataloging format and cataloging
Excellent verbal, written, and interpersonal communication skills
Familiarity with common subscription database collections at an academic
library.

*Duties and Responsibilities:*
Research best practices for electronic resource management.
Populate ERMS with information about the libraries electronic resources
collection.
Create and update records of resources, licensing, organizations, and
usages statistics in ERMS.
Review, code, and organize the electronic resources license agreements and
contracts.
Gather, manage, and assess electronic resources COUNTER compliant usage
statistics.
Assist in creating workflow for future use of the ERMS and create guides
instructing others on the workflow.
Work collaboratively to coordinate responses to reports of access problems.
